Abstract

The article from the methodological point of view analyzes the evolution of the views of historians and philosophers on the relationship of history as a science to fiction from antiquity to the present. Particular attention is paid to the influence of postmodernism on modern historiography. In the interpretation of postmodernists, the line that separates the historical narrative from the artistic one is essentially erased. Nevertheless, at the same time, according to the authors, the postmodern challenge in a new way highlighted the complex nature of the interaction between the source and the researcher; it increased the requirements for the content and language of the scientific historical text.
